ssh-keygen -t rsa
命令。,2. 将公钥上传到服务器:使用ssh-copy-id 用户名@服务器地址
命令。,3. 登录服务器:使用ssh 用户名@服务器地址
命令登录。 如何在海外服务器上设置秘钥
在海外服务器上设置秘钥是一项重要的安全措施,可以确保您的数据和通信的安全性,以下是设置秘钥的详细步骤:
1. 生成密钥对
您需要生成一对密钥,包括公钥和私钥,公钥用于加密数据,而私钥用于解密数据。
使用以下命令生成密钥对:
“`shell
openssl genrsa out private_key.pem 2048
“`
这将生成一个名为 private_key.pem
的私钥文件。
接下来,使用以下命令从私钥中提取公钥:
“`shell
openssl rsa in private_key.pem pubout out public_key.pem
“`
这将生成一个名为 public_key.pem
的公钥文件。
2. 上传密钥到服务器
将生成的私钥和公钥文件上传到您的海外服务器,您可以使用 FTP、SCP 或其他安全的文件传输方法来完成此操作。
3. 安装 OpenSSL
在服务器上安装 OpenSSL 软件包,以便能够使用密钥进行加密和解密操作,具体的安装步骤取决于您的服务器操作系统。
对于基于 Debian/Ubuntu 的系统,可以使用以下命令安装 OpenSSL:
“`shell
sudo aptget update
sudo aptget install openssl
“`
对于基于 CentOS/RHEL 的系统,可以使用以下命令安装 OpenSSL:
“`shell
sudo yum install openssl
“`
4. 配置服务器端
在服务器上配置相应的服务或应用程序,以使用公钥进行身份验证和加密通信,这通常涉及编辑配置文件,并将公钥文件的内容添加到适当的位置。
具体的配置步骤取决于您要保护的服务或应用程序,请参考相关的文档或指南,了解如何在您的特定环境中配置密钥。
5. 测试和验证
完成配置后,进行测试以确保密钥正常工作,您可以尝试使用私钥进行身份验证,并检查是否可以成功建立加密连接。
请注意,以上步骤仅为一般指导,并且可能因您的具体环境和需求而有所不同,在进行任何安全配置之前,请务必仔细阅读相关文档,并根据您的实际情况进行调整。
希望这些信息对您有所帮助!如果您有任何进一步的问题,请随时提问。
最新评论
本站CDN与莫名CDN同款、亚太CDN、速度还不错,值得推荐。
感谢推荐我们公司产品、有什么活动会第一时间公布!
我在用这类站群服务器、还可以. 用很多年了。